As Colorado River reservoirs shrink, Arizona warns of a legal fight
As Colorado River reservoirs shrink, the water-starved river system is drawing criticism regarding the Trump administration's plan. Due to these concerns and dwindling resources, Arizona has warned that it could launch a legal fight.
